One of the primary factors influencing your choice of guardrails is adherence to safety standards and regulations. Each jurisdiction has specific guidelines that dictate the design and installation of guardrails. It's important to familiarize yourself with these regulations to ensure compliance and safeguard against liability issues. For instance, the American Association of State Highway and Transportation Officials (AASHTO) provides clear criteria for guardrail specifications. Guardrails come in various materials, including steel, wood, and plastic composites, each with its own pros and cons. Consider factors such as longevity, maintenance, and environmental conditions when making your decision. For example, steel guardrails typically offer superior durability and resistance to harsh weather conditions, making them ideal for locations prone to extreme weather. Budget plays a significant role in purchasing decisions. It’s crucial to assess not only the initial cost of the guardrails but also the long-term maintenance and replacement costs. In addition to functionality, the aesthetics of guardrails can influence your decision, particularly in scenic areas or urban environments. People often prefer guardrails that blend well with the surroundings. Additionally, consider the environmental impact of the materials used for your guardrail. Opting for eco-friendly materials can not only benefit the environment but also enhance your project's image.
